Benny Zable is a radical performance and visual artist. Benny wears  a gas mask and white gloves. Have you seen him?  He has been present at many camps to defend nature: Save The Franklin, Stop Roxby Uranium mine, to stop the Whitehaven Coal Mine, Stop Adani, Occupy Wall Street and numerous campaigns to keep Uranium  in the ground and for peace.Today Benny gives us the secret of staying so productively active year after year. He also describes arcology; the principle of building living spaces and towns that nurture community in harmony with the natural world.  Correction: Apologies: Benny was not a visual designer at the Aquarius Festival .
